IP查询
查询
你查询的IP:[60.63.187.78] 地理位置:中国–上海–上海电信/东方有线
最新查询
123.244.47.23
123.103.206.201
121.76.101.36
117.106.81.103
116.199.194.70
123.128.50.99
119.48.23.231
210.2.237.185
218.96.187.158
60.63.187.78
123.138.7.226
122.102.118.58
203.91.96.252
221.200.9.41
125.169.174.19
116.70.96.237
122.119.214.85
203.174.7.120
120.72.128.36
118.239.17.107
124.6.64.41
123.184.50.0
124.242.223.238
117.122.128.50
124.160.254.144
124.47.84.168
120.32.57.81
211.136.65.9
202.122.64.229
221.12.207.89
116.2.147.26